IT'S now going to cost €6 to see one of the country's most stunning natural attractions -- after a council imposed a viewing charge for the first time.
The Cliffs of Moher, a 600ft- high natural landmark in Co Clare, will now be pay per view, in a controversial move seemingly designed to cover the cost of a failing visitors' centre.
The charge will apply to adults only and will also cover admission to the visitor centre.
The introduction of the charge comes against the background of the Cliffs Of Moher Visitor Centre Ltd incurring combined losses of €500,000 in 2008 and 2009.
Director for the Cliffs of Moher Visitor Experience, Katherine Webster described the new pricing structure as "family friendly" and said a single charge simplified their pricing structure for visitors.
